indifference
uncountable noun: If you accuse someone of indifference to something, you mean that they have a complete lack of interest in it.

indifference in American English
the quality, state, or fact of being indifferent
noun: lack of interest or concern

indifference in British English
noun: the fact or state of being indifferent; lack of care or concern
